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9992 947792 7681 4949677 69061377
1938523746 102679703 507967131
1938523746 102679703 507967131
80527 93 265248 5875821 97795
All about undefined
Interested in learning more?
1938523746 102679703 507967131
80527 93 265248 5875821 97795
See more
28969769 49816449
057145 77055 8370281 3271
See more
35975 697605
952355 979 852908377
See more